Torrance Police Remind Motorists to Slow Down

Serious accidents can be minimized when motorists slow down, according to the Torrance Police Department.

The following statement was posted to the Torrance Police Department's Nixle account:

Traffic collisions are an unfortunate reality when driving a motor vehicle.  These collisions are referred to as “Accidents” because more often than not, one of the involved parties made a mistake and it truly was an “Accident.”  A recent study conducted by the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ration found that speeding is one of the most prevalent factors in car crashes.  Unfortunately, when an accident occurs and one or both of the involved vehicles are speeding, reaction time is diminished, and the likelihood that the collision will result in a serious injury or death increases. 

The Torrance Police Department Traffic Division would like to remind you that accidents will happen.  However, together we can minimize serious accidents by slowing down and always driving at or below the speed limit.  Bottom line, driving mistakes don’t have to be fatal mistakes.
